South Africa, June 4 -- With the explosive rise of AI-driven assistants like ChatGPT, Siri, Alexa, and Google Assistant the way people search is fundamentally changing. Traditional typed searches are giving way to voice commands, conversational queries, and intelligent prompts. But, when it comes to location based searches (or prompts), behind this shiny new interface lies something essential: the same old data.
Whether someone asks Siri "Where can i find a good burger in Rosebank" or types a query into an AI chat window, these platforms don't invent answers from thin air.
